Before your first session, know that your BetterUp Coach is in your corner. Our coaches support you in everything from creating better habits to reaching your personal and professional goals. What you talk about is up to you and everything is 100% confidential. In your first video coaching session, you and your coach will get to know one another and explore what coaching is and how it can help you achieve your goals. In your following sessions, your coach will be an unbiased partner, helping you answer questions that will guide you on your path to growth and success.

Coach Availability
If a BetterUp Coach that you would like to connect with does not have availability that matches your preferences, we encourage you to find a time that does work for you on their schedule and to schedule a session. Once you have done that, you will be able to send your new coach a message and see if they are able to accommodate a session on a date/time that may not be listed on their schedule.
If you and your coach are not a fit based on schedule differences, please view the "Exploring More Coach Options" section within this article to curate additional recommendations based on your "time of the day" scheduling preferences.
